Output 31a8a55774e9fbdc50a3938ee320b35f61b394af50b2a95d4844b5fc1ff7cd20:19

value
14527144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ae653a767667a1c2c8868137a541a846a92b734 OP_EQUAL
address
349FQv61mVae48aVYx1DaBBf76eAJkK2vd
transaction
31a8a55774e9fbdc50a3938ee320b35f61b394af50b2a95d4844b5fc1ff7cd20
confirmations
295904
spent
true